Product Overview

The CBB21/MPP series metallized polypropylene film capacitors are designed for electronic equipment applications. These capacitors feature a non-inductive winding structure with metallized polypropylene film and a tin-plated copper wire or tin-plated copper-clad steel wire lead. Encapsulated with flame-retardant epoxy resin powder, they offer excellent self-healing properties, low loss, and low internal temperature rise. Their typical applications include DC blocking, coupling, decoupling, filtering, bypassing, and other high-frequency, DC, AC, and pulse circuits.

Storage Conditions

  • Temperature: Max 35
  • Relative Humidity: Max 80%
  • Storage Time: Maximum 12 months (based on the production date marked on the packaging bag)

Usage Rules

  • Do not exceed the upper category temperature during use.
  • Avoid overload operation.
  • Do not exceed the maximum pulse current during use.
  • Avoid repeated squeezing at the lead wire root.
  • Pay attention to the tip of the lead wires.
  • Soldering:
    • Wave Soldering: TP 110 for 120 seconds; Ts 120 for 45 seconds. For P 7.5mm, T 4mm, soldering time < 4 seconds.
    • Soldering Iron: Tip temperature not exceeding 350, time not exceeding 3 seconds.
    • Lead wire film capacitors are not suitable for reflow soldering.
